BruceW
07-19-2010, 05:14 AM
From what I've heard it's because in the spring the bioligists do some scouting/game counts in a few wmu's and these are used as an average comparison to other wmu's. Tag allotment is based on these numbers and historical harvest rates. Post season we're asked about success rates. I know a lot of people blow these off, but as I unerstand it they are relied upon so should not be underrated.
I don't know if that's accurate, it's just what I've heard via the grapevine, but is makes sense, anyway?

http://www.ab-conservation.com/go/default/assets/File/Programs/Wildlife/AUS/Aerial_Ungulate_Survey_2009-2010_Final_Report_Draft_ACAwebsite.pdf

Here is a link to the 2009/10 winter aerial survey. It's unfortunate F&W just doesn't have the funding to actually get the info. needed for wildlife management. Antelope, goats, and Zama-Hays Bison are surveyed every year, and then the rest is left to anecdotal observation. Even Sheep zones are usually only surveyed every three to four years. Take a look at past surveys, only a tiny portion of the province is covered.

Duk Dog
07-22-2010, 07:44 AM
Initial means the draw hasn't happened yet. The antelope draw is in August. Some of our sheep draws work on priority points, some are random lottery which is the case of the sheep tag Rack's wife got.
